ROPES AND DREAMS. Who would have thought that rope could look so effective? 


Morgan from the brick house certainly did. I just can't get over how good it looks. 


 She was faced with the challenge of creating zones in a large warehouse that was to be used as an upholstery workshop/ teaching space/ office.


 Her cost effective and beautiful solution was to create these rope walls, which allow both light to filter through the whole area and the feeling of space to remain.
